Bitcoin's price is notoriously volatile, swinging wildly between highs and dips. This trend can be attributed to a confluence of factors.

Initially, Bitcoin's supply is limited to 21 million units, creating scarcity that can push demand and therefore its price.

Furthermore, Bitcoin's distributed nature means it's not controlled by any government. This independence can lead to speculation and price swings.

An additional element is the global adoption of Bitcoin as a medium of exchange. Increased use can fuel demand, pushing the price upward.

On the other hand, negative events, such as regulatory crackdowns or security incidents, can impact investor belief, causing a price decline.

The intertwined interplay of these factors creates the volatile nature of Bitcoin's price. Understanding these dynamics is crucial for both enthusiasts navigating the digital asset market.
